A 28-year-old motorcyclist suffered head injuries after a crash in Whittle-le-Woods.

Police are appealing for witnesses after the incident yesterday morning.

Officers were called around 7.55am on November 21 following reports of an accident close to the junction of Preston Road (A6) and Cow Well Lane.

A Mini Cooper car had been involved in a collision with a Kawasaki motorbike.

The rider of the Kawasaki, a 28-year-old man from Clayton Brook, suffered significant head injuries and was taken to Royal Preston Hospital for treatment.

The driver of the Mini, a 21-year-old man from Chorley, was not injured.

The road was closed for more than five hours while accident investigators attended the scene.

Sgt Tracey Ward, of Lancashire Police, said: “We are appealing for witnesses following a serious road traffic collision in Whittle-le-Woods.

“A man has been seriously injured and we want to establish exactly what happened.

“If you saw the incident and have yet to speak to police please come forward.”
